NASA's Earth Observing System Data and Information System (EOSDIS) is a comprehensive distributed data system for supporting earth science research.

Key Features

  • Data ingestion, archiving, and distribution
  • Data search and discovery
  • Data processing and quality control
  • Multi-mission support
